Safety

Electric wall fireplaces are a popular alternative to traditional fireplaces. They offer a cozy, attractive and energy-efficient alternative. These fireplaces are safe to use and offer the warmth needed in any house. They also ensure a smokeless, clean environment. There are many possibilities for these fireplaces, however, they all produce beautiful bed embers that create a realistic flame display. They are perfect for renovations, apartments or condominiums that do not have chimneys. They're also an excellent choice for households who have children or pets because they don't produce a real fire.

However, there are certain safety tips that should be adhered to when using an electric fireplace. It is crucial to keep all materials that ignite at least three feet from the fireplace. This will decrease the risk of your belongings getting burned. Avoid touching any surfaces of the fireplace that are hot, for instance the heating element and the vents that blast hot air out. It is also important to not block these vents because they must be opened to allow the unit to function safely.

Another important feature to look for in an electric wall fireplace is a safety screen that will help prevent accidental burns. This is particularly useful if your home has a limited space, or if there are pets or children. Some models also have the ability to control the fireplace with a remote that lets you switch the fireplace on or off from any room. This will prevent the fireplace from accidentally turned on while you're not present in the room.

Certain models come with a timer built in that will turn off the fireplace after a certain amount of time. This feature is great for those who do not remember to turn off the fireplace or have difficulty remembering.

Also, it is recommended to disconnect the fireplace when not being used. It could overload the electrical system, causing an increase in fire danger. Do not put water or other liquids into the fireplace. Finally, it's a good idea to keep your electric fireplace in a separate circuit from other appliances. This will avoid tripping or power outages.

Installation

The newest fashion in interior design is the wall-mounted electric fireplace. They are stylish and energy efficient. They are also easy to install. They can also be positioned in a flush position to give the wall an elegant look. The mounting kit for the majority of these fireplaces comes with all the necessary hardware. Certain models come with an air blower which pushes warm air into the room.

Installation is a breeze however, you must adhere to the directions carefully. The owner's manual will provide you with specific instructions on how to frame and secure the unit. The manual will also provide you with specific guidelines on the clearances you need to leave to prevent fire hazards.

Start by checking that the location you've chosen is suitable for your fire. If you are unsure, drill a small hole into a small section of the wall. This will let you know what kind of wall you have. Once you've completed this you can use the template included with the fireplace to mark the wall that you'll have to fix it. The brackets should be screwed to the wall. Check that the brackets are straight and the fire is properly positioned to ensure a neat finish.

You'll also need to think about the height that you would like your fire to be. If you have a frameless fireplace, it is possible to prefer an elongated or flush mount ledge for the fire. To ensure the safety of your heater you should make sure it is at least 400mm away from flames, such as fabrics.
